Johann Georg Megerle von Mühlfeld


Johann Georg Megerle von Mühlfeld was an Austrian naturalist.
From 1802 on he worked as the curator's assistant at the entomological collection of the Natural-Animal Cabinet in Vienna. He later became an official in the administration.
He published the Mineralogical Pocket Book in 1807, but abandoned mineralogy thereafter. In 1813, he published Österreichs Färbepflanzen.
He was the younger son of Johann Baptist Megerle von Mühlfeld, who was known as von Mühlfeld since 1803.
